Output 7dda631df62d848edde0b534aa33a2e7f19265154f94920d6dac8c9243a78790:1

value
9439886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ce6921076c7cdfe4a8917ee72e438a2332e46127 OP_EQUAL
address
3LWR4Z34XPp7ZDz2cTU1TTSsMaH92KP6tg
transaction
7dda631df62d848edde0b534aa33a2e7f19265154f94920d6dac8c9243a78790
spent
true